Dress Code Overview

Attending the Masters Golf Tournament is a prestigious experience, and adhering to the appropriate dress code is essential. Augusta National Golf Club has specific guidelines that attendees are expected to follow. The emphasis is on maintaining a neat, professional appearance while being comfortable throughout the day.

Recommended Attire for Men

Men typically opt for smart casual attire. Here are some suggestions:

  • Shirts: Polo shirts or collared shirts in solid colors or subtle patterns are ideal. Avoid loud graphics or slogans.
  • Pants: Khakis or dress shorts are acceptable. Denim is usually frowned upon, particularly if it’s distressed.
  • Footwear: Comfortable loafers or golf shoes are recommended. Sneakers are generally acceptable as long as they are clean and presentable.

Recommended Attire for Women

Women have a slightly broader range of options. Suggested attire includes:

  • Tops: Blouses or polo-style shirts are recommended. Avoid overly revealing or casual tops.
  • Bottoms: Knee-length skirts, dress shorts, or slacks are suitable. Jeans should be avoided.
  • Footwear: Stylish sandals or comfortable flats work well. Heels are not advised due to the walking involved.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What should I wear to the Masters Golf Tournament?
Attendees typically wear smart casual attire. Collared shirts, golf polos, and tailored shorts or slacks are appropriate. Comfortable shoes are essential, as you will be walking on grass and uneven terrain.

Are there any dress code restrictions at the Masters?
Yes, the Masters has specific dress code guidelines. Avoid denim, t-shirts, and overly casual attire. Additionally, hats should be worn with the brim facing forward, and no offensive graphics or slogans are allowed.

Can I wear a jacket or blazer to the Masters?
Yes, wearing a jacket or blazer is acceptable and can add a touch of elegance to your outfit. Many attendees opt for light blazers, especially during cooler mornings or evenings.

What type of footwear is recommended for the Masters?
Comfortable, closed-toe shoes are recommended. Golf shoes, sneakers, or casual loafers are suitable choices. Avoid high heels or sandals, as they may not provide adequate support for walking on the course.

Is it advisable to check the weather before deciding what to wear?
Absolutely. Weather conditions can vary significantly during the tournament. Checking the forecast will help you choose appropriate layers and accessories, such as umbrellas or rain jackets, if necessary.

Should I consider wearing a hat or sunglasses at the Masters?
Yes, wearing a hat and sunglasses is advisable. A hat provides sun protection, while sunglasses help reduce glare, enhancing your overall comfort during the event.
